How do remote Design Engineers using SolidWorks typically collaborate with team members on complex projects?

Remote Design Engineers using SolidWorks often collaborate through cloud-based platforms and specialized project management tools to share models and updates in real time. They frequently participate in virtual meetings, screen-sharing sessions, and use shared file repositories to review designs and provide feedback. Clear communication and version control are essential to ensure that all team members are aligned and that design iterations are tracked efficiently. This collaborative approach allows teams to work seamlessly across different locations while maintaining high productivity and design quality.

What does a remote Design Engineer using SolidWorks do?

A remote Design Engineer who uses SolidWorks is responsible for creating, modifying, and analyzing 3D models and engineering drawings for various products or components. They collaborate with teams virtually to design parts, assemblies, and systems, ensuring they meet technical specifications and industry standards. Using SolidWorks, they can simulate how a design will perform, identify potential issues, and help streamline the manufacturing process—all while working from a remote location. Their work is crucial in product development, prototyping, and improving existing designs.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Design Engineer (Remote, SolidWorks), and why are they important?

To thrive as a Design Engineer working remotely with SolidWorks, you need a solid background in mechanical or product design, a relevant engineering degree, and proficiency in 3D CAD modeling. Expertise in SolidWorks software, familiarity with PLM/PDM systems, and, in some cases, certification such as CSWP (Certified SolidWorks Professional) are typically required. Strong problem-solving, time management, and clear communication skills set standout professionals apart, especially in remote roles. These abilities ensure precise, innovative designs, effective collaboration, and on-time project delivery in a virtual engineering environment.

MICHAEL BAKER IN ALASKA

Michael Baker's first office in Alaska opened in 1942. Since then, we have played a key role in some of Alaska's most renowned infrastructure projects, including groundbreaking projects on the North Slope and the Trans-Alaska Pipeline System. We continue to focus on cold regions engineering-pipelines, transportation, hydrology, geotechnical, specialty professional services, permitting and regulatory compliance, and GIS and LiDAR mapping. 

DESCRIPTION

We are seeking a highly motivated engineer to join our transportation team in either our Fairbanks or Anchorage offices. We will help you continue to grow and develop your engineering skills and profession through exposure to a variety of civil design projects including highways, airports, building sites, and oil and gas infrastructure. We also offer opportunities for fieldwork experience in design data collection and construction contract administration.

As a part of our Civil Engineering team, the Transportation Civil Engineer will perform a lead role for tasks including site review, field documentation, data collection, data organization, data analysis, preparation of technical reports, and production of bid-ready plans, specifications and construction cost estimates.
